Chuck Grassley, born September 17, 1933 (age 92), is a United States Senator from Iowa. He is a member of the Republican Party and throughout the current Congress has voted with a majority of his Republican colleagues eight-three percent of the time.[1]He was elected as a Representative in 1974 January 3, 1981 when he was elected United States Senator. [2] He is the ranking member of the Senate Finance Committee and is influential in health care negotiations. Grassley received his graduate degree from the University of Northern Iowa.
